Bob Sweeney

American television director and actor (1918–1992)

Bob Sweeney is a human[1]. His place of birth was San Francisco[2]. He was born on +1918-10-19T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Westlake Village[4]. He died on +1992-06-07T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as an actor[6], television director[7], television actor[8], film actor[9], and film producer[10].
